The lightest element on the periodic table with properties similar to bromine is chlorine. Like bromine, chlorine is a halogen with similar chemical properties, such as being highly reactive and having a tendency to form salts. However, chlorine is lighter and has a lower atomic number than bromine.
Element number 35 on the periodic table is bromine (Br). It is a halogen, typically found as a diatomic molecule in its elemental form. Bromine is a reddish-brown liquid at room temperature with a strong, unpleasant odor.

Bromine is an element on the periodic table. It has an atomic number of 35. It can be found near the right side of the table. Bromine is located in the Halogens group, which is group 7A or 17, and is also in period 4.
